( XmIsTeR | 2010. 09. 05., v – 01:39 )

yaffs2 sokkal érzékenyebb a vártlan leállásokra mint az ext rendszerek, legalábbis ez a tapasztalat xda-n.
Ami a wear-leveling-et illeti XSR-nek hívják a réteget, már belinkeltem az info-t egy hsz-ben, de akk mégegyszer: http://www.samsung.com/global/business/semiconductor/products/fusionmem…
Az RFS is igényli ezt a réteget, szóval be van építve valahova az FS és a NAND közé.

Ma már szerintem a flash-re optimalizált fs-ek lényege, hogy figyelembe veszik a flash eltérő szerkezetét az algoritmusokban, ezért gyorsabbak, de ez az RFS-ről nem mondható el, az ugyanis alig több, mint egy szimpla vfat. (vfat-ként csatolva is tökéletesen működik egyébként)
Vagy csak olyan NAND-okon érdemes alkalmazni őket, amiken nincs ilyen köztes réteg.

Shutdown/reboot esetén gondolom(remélem) benne van az Androidban egy umount /data vagy umount all, ennek nem néztem utána, de eddig semmi hibát nem generáltak a filerendszeren az újraindítások.

---
BME-VIK '09
Compaq Mini 311 - N270 @ 2323 MHz - 3GB DDR3 @ 1240 MHz - ION